         <title>5. The reflection on the role of teachers </title>
         <author>acostavallejostatiana</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/acostavallejostatiana/humun8ekhbbjsgci/wish/3459540697</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<p>The article “Redefining the role of the teacher in education through Artificial General Intelligence (AGI)” by Haci Hasan Yolcu highlights how AGI will profoundly transform the education system, especially the role of teachers. The teacher is no longer expected to be the sole source of knowledge, but a facilitator and guide accompanying the student in personalized learning processes. AGI, having the ability to adapt content and pace according to individual needs, offers opportunities for a more meaningful education, but also poses ethical challenges related to data privacy and the balance between the technological and the human.</p><p>In this new scenario, the role of the English teacher must go beyond teaching grammar rules or vocabulary. English teachers are called to integrate AI tools such as language models, chatbots or voice analyzers that support the development of communicative skills in a more dynamic and individualized way. However, their key role will be to select, contextualize and humanize these resources, ensuring that they align with pedagogical objectives. Emotional accompaniment, intercultural competence and communication strategies will continue to be uniquely human contributions to language teaching.</p>]]></description>
